FRIDAY, FEBRUARY 12, 2010
THIS IS ABRAHAM LINCOLN'S BIRTHDAY
President Lincoln wrote this proclamation setting a
National Day of Prayer. It was later ruled
unconstitutional because of separation of church
and state.
Now, therefore, in compliance with the request, and
fully concurring in the views of the Senate, I do, by
this my proclamation, designate and set apart
Thursday, the 30th. day of April, 1863, as a day of
national humiliation, fasting and prayer. And I do
hereby request all the People to abstain, on that day,
from their ordinary secular pursuits, and to unite, at
their several places of public worship and their
respective homes, in keeping the day holy to the Lord,
and devoted to the humble discharge of the religious
duties proper to that solemn occasion.

All this being done, in sincerity and truth, let us then
rest humbly in the hope authorized by the Divine
teachings, that the united cry of the Nation will be heard
on high, and answered with blessings, no less than the
pardon of our national sins, and the restoration of our
now divided and suffering Country, to its former happy
condition of unity and peace.

In witness whereof, I have hereunto set my hand and
caused the seal of the United States to be affixed.

Done at the City of Washington, this thirtieth day of March,
in the year of our Lord one thousand eight hundred and
sixty-three, and of the Independence of the United States
the eighty seventh. By the President: Abraham Lincoln

In Exodus, a powerful and direct encounter with
the glory of God leads to the transfiguration of
Moses and his transformation as a leader of
worship and community. Moses returns from
Sinai with the two tablets of the covenant. His
face shines in a way that frightens the people,
so he begins to wear a veil when he instructs
the people, but takes it off when offering worship
in the tabernacle.

THIS IS VALENTINES DAY
Emperor Claudius II of Rome, was having a difficult
time recruiting men as soldiers. He believed that the
men did not want to leave their sweethearts and he
canceled all engagements and marriages throughout
Rome. St. Valentine, a priest in Rome at the time,
secretly married couples. He was caught, arrested
and condemned. He was beaten to death and
beheaded on February 14th, around the year 270.
• Valentine Day greetings became popular during the
middles ages.
• During the 1800’s Valentines began to be
manufactured in factories.
• Norcross, now known as Hallmark, began to publish
